The room was exceptionally clean and tidy. The heating was working very well, which is always a must with winter stays. My favourite thing about the room was definitely the bathroom — very cosy, and with a permanently heated hot water vent imbedded into the bathtub. For a room with a single bed, the room was very spacious, feeling like a real home. The staff was friendly and very helpful with requests, such as asking for an extra pillow/duvet. Breakfast was definitely a highlight as well, with enough variety to suit everyone. The breakfast room is decorated very nicely and tastefully, there are great selections for tea and coffee. Overall, a lovely and comfortable experience for anyone looking to stay in Baden Baden on a budget.
If you don’t have a car and wish to go to the city centre often during you stay, it might be a problem: there is only one consistent bus line, which comes once every hour, and after 19:30 there are no more buses back or to the city, so you have to call a taxi. Before my booking I definitely underestimated the location distance and connections between the hotel and the city, so this information would have been helpful to know beforehand. However, it shouldn’t be a problem if you plan your time well, and don’t mind the waiting times. You are also close to the Black Forest, and there are many lovely hiking trails around.
